IsabellaCOWANPeacefully, at Nightingale House Nursing Home, Paisley on Thursday 27th February 2025. Isabel beloved wife of the late Davie, devoted mother of David, Peter and Andrew and mother in Law of Carol, Annette and Debbie, much-loved Grandmother of Charlie and cherished sister in law of Mamie, Betty and Jessie and the late Sam. She will be sadly missed by all friends and family.

Funeral service to be held at The Hurlet Crematorium on Monday 17th March at 12 noon, to which all friends and family are respectfully invited.

Family flowers only please. Donations in lieu of flowers to Alzheimer Scotland.
